Dumbarton Goal drought a concern

- Jack Crawford

I was hoping after we’d scored four goals in two games a few weeks ago that we’d push on and start to find the net more often after the drought, but it seems as if that isn’t the case.

The stats don’t lie and our last goal against a full-time team came back on Boxing Day. Heading into the play-offs against the likes of Ayr or Raith with that kind of record will only end one way.

Saturday isn’t worth talking about but I actually thought we were OK against Dundee United on Tuesday. A bit of composure in the final third and we might have taken something. We really need to find form, and goals, ahead of the playoffs, where every Dumbarton fan has resigned to being in.
